Customer Service Advisor

Customer Service Advisor — Williams Motor Group

Full-time | 40-hour week (1 in 3 Saturdays including 8.30am-12.30pm rotations)

Performance Bonus, £27,600 base salary + up to £6,000 commission per year

About the Role

The role of Customer Service Advisor at Williams Motor Group is pivotal behind the scenes—handling all bookings and ensuring our aftersales operations run smoothly. This is a telephone-based position ideal for those who thrive in professional customer interactions, high-volume call environments, and a structured, performance-driven workplace.

Responsibilities

As an advisor, you’ll:

  • Manage inbound and outbound customer calls efficiently and professionally
  • Arrange service and aftersales appointments with precision
  • Accurately capture and update customer details across internal systems
  • Provide clear communication and set realistic expectations
  • Collaborate closely with service and aftersales teams to support daily operations
  • Work efficiently in a fast-paced call-handling environment

This role is non-customer-facing, ensuring 100% focus on telephone support, system accuracy, and ticket resolution.

Earnings & Progression

  • Base salary: £27,600
  • Performance commission: Up to £6,000 per year
  • Opportunity to build earnings over time while developing within a supportive environment

Working Hours & Pattern

  • Full-time (approx. 40 hours/week)
  • Monday–Friday shifts: 8:00am–6:00pm
  • Saturdays: 1 in 3 rotations (8:30am–12:30pm)

What We’re Looking For

We seek candidates with: ✔ Preferred: Experience in telephone-based customer service or call handling ✔ Not essential: Will train suitable applicants ✔ Strong verbal communication skills and a confident telephone demeanour ✔ Exceptional accuracy, organisation, and attention to detail ✔ Ability to thrive in a fast-paced, performance-focused environment ✔ A positive, professional, and team-driven attitude

What We Offer

  • Commission scheme: Potential to earn £6,000+ annually
  • Training & coaching: Ongoing mentorship and skill development
  • Career progression: Clear opportunities across Williams Motor Group
  • Perks:
    • Staff car options & Group-wide discounts
    • 47 days paid leave (30 pa + rise to 35 with tenure)
    • Medical cash plan to support everyday health needs
    • Employee Assistance Programme (EAP) for confidential support
    • Company pension & life assurance
    • Wellbeing initiatives (courses + mental health/physical health support)
    • Annual staff summer event & children’s Christmas party
    • £1,000 employment referral bonus
